みちすがら
adverb
along the way; on the road; while walking
1. along the way; on the road; while walking
While traveling along a road or path. Describes something done or observed during a journey. A literary and somewhat elegant expression.
(みち)すがら(はな)(なが)めた。
I admired the flowers along the way.
(みち)すがら友人(ゆうじん)にばったり()った。
I happened to run into a friend on the way.
(えき)までの(みち)すがら、(むかし)のことをあれこれ(おも)()した。
On the way to the station, I recalled various memories from the past.

A literary adverb with an elegant, slightly old-fashioned feel. More evocative than the everyday 途中(とちゅう)で (on the way). Often appears in essays, fiction, and travel writing.

SIMILAR WORDS:

  • 途中(とちゅう)で — on the way (neutral, everyday)
  • (みち)すがら — along the way (literary, evocative)
  • 道中(どうちゅう) — during a journey (slightly formal)

The すがら element is a classical particle meaning "while; along" and is not productive in modern Japanese.
